I started by stamping and die cutting all of the pieces in this set, including the bike, wheels, baskets, doggie, flowers, apples, books, and all the other little accessory pieces.  I did stamp the bike frame and wheels on Glossy Cardstock.. it gives such a great solid image!

Then I created a background for my card by applying embossing paste (mixed with glitter) onto a vanilla 4"x5-1/4" panel, and adding a strip of Pick a Pattern Washi tape as the "road".  I adhered the brick panel to a folded Real Red card.  For more info on applying the embossing paste brick background to your card click to watch my free Embossing Paste video tutorial.

Step 1:  stamp Bike Ride images

Step 2: color in images with makers, or, stamp with the coordinating stamps as I did here

Step 3: die cut with matching Bike Ride framelit dies in the Big Shot

Step 4: assemble pieces on your card

Step 5: store extra pieces in little containers for future use

Enamel shapes, or White Perfect Accents (#138416, pg 196) are so fun when colored with a Black Sharpie pen – they make the perfect sunflower center accent or the best addition to the center of the bike wheels!

Using Stampin' Dimensionals under the bike frame is a great way to give this card fun depth, dimension and interest!

Special Notes:

  • be sure to add the cute handle streamers.. they are die cuts in the framelit set. I put one drop of fine-tip glue on the handles and added the streamers… so cute!  I mean SERIOUSLY so cute!
  • for fun glossy accents, color some White Perfect Accents with a Black Sharpie marker and add to the sunflower centers and on the center of the wheels!
